 Is there Assisted Access? 

Yes  - We have assisted parking space to allow room for wheelchairs, walking aids etc. Assisted ramps into the tattoo convention. Assisted toilets in all toilet blocks.

Is there camping?

Yes, for car clubs, show cars & traders only.

What time does it open? 

General Admission Gates open at 10.30am

What time does it close? 

Ink and Engines Fest finishes at 11pm on Saturday and 8pm on Sunday 

Can I bring food and drink?

No, leave your picnic at home! We are bringing you a delicious selection of food trucks and a bar so there will be a wide selection to choose between. 
There are also dairy free, gluten free and vegan options available.
